The Israeli government’s actions in Gaza “can no longer be justified,” said German Chancellor Friedrich Merz on Monday, signalling a profound shift in tone from one of Europe’s traditionally most staunch supporters of Israel.

    I had written this in a different thread regarding the topic already. I think it is important to understand that these remain hollow words, unless there is actual real actions taken, something the German government continues to oppose.

    Yeah, dont believe a word coming out of Merz mouth, unless there is actual actions.

    The new coalition plans to treat Israel “like a NATO partner” in arms exports, effectively removing any oversight and any chance to appeal against arms exports used for war crimes.

    They also want to make further financial contributions to UNRWA “dependent on extensive reforms”. Furthermore they want to remove funding from any scientific, cultural or education project that is deemed “hostile to Israel”.

    In February Merz told Netanyahu he would find a way to have Netanyahu visit Germany without the arrest warrant by the ICC being executed. The only way to do that is to defy the ICC. Just two weeks ago the German president Steinmeier invited the Israeli president Herzog to Germany and subsequently visited Herzog and Netanyahu in Israel too. Aside from shaking hands with a wanted war criminal, Herzog also is known for genocidal statements against Palestinians.

    Just last week Germany opposed the EU to reevaluate the association agreement with Israel on the basis that the agreement requires conforming to international law and human rights.

    The reason why Merz is saying something now is because Germany is getting more and more isolated. However so far Germany wants to only talk, while giving Israel the weapons, money and diplomatic cover to finish its genocidal onslaught.

    Just like Israel will not react to any words and only understand concrete pressure, Germany will not wane from the side of Israel unless forced to do so.
